Summary
We are seeking an experienced Site Manager to lead the on-site delivery of a Grade 2, four-storey old mill conversion into apartments. The project is currently in the enabling and structural repair phase, with the developer aiming for an early September start. The successful candidate will be responsible for managing all site activities, ensuring compliance with health and safety standards, quality control, and programme adherence throughout the 12-month duration. This role requires strong leadership and coordination skills, with a focus on heritage building experience and apartment conversions. The Site Manager will oversee subcontractors, manage site logistics, and maintain effective communication with all stakeholders to ensure the project is delivered safely, on time, and to the required standards.
Key Responsibilities
Manage and supervise all site activities related to the enabling works and structural repairs of a Grade 2 listed building. Coordinate subcontractors and site operatives to maintain programme, quality, and safety standards. Ensure full compliance with health and safety regulations and site rules. Oversee site set-up, welfare, and logistics to support smooth operations. Conduct daily briefings, toolbox talks, and maintain site documentation. Liaise with client representatives, consultants, and project teams to resolve issues promptly. Monitor progress and report on site performance, quality, and costs. Skills
